Le Peloton Café — Café Review | Condé Nast Traveler

"Okay, you’ve just walked in. First impressions? This minimalist but colorful café focuses on two things: coffee and cycling. (It's owned by the American-Kiwi duo who founded Bike About Tours.) Who else was there? Expect a mix of travelers and expats who frequent the café for its excellent coffee, riverside location, and community of cyclists. Guests are often hovered around the horseshoe bar chatting up the baristas and owners. The raison d’être : the coffee. How was it? Flat whites, drip coffee, espresso—this place has it all. Was there food, too, and if so, worth getting? The menu is largely filled with sweet treats, like croissants and waffles served with a side of jam. How about the staff: what did you think? The staff knows what they're doing and they take the time to do it well. In other words, don't order here if you're in a rush. Who should go here? Since the owners renovated the café in 2022, there are more seats for lingering as well as standing spots at the counter. Still, many regulars stop in while they’re on a leisurely stroll through the Marais or en route to the Seine river, located only a block away." - Lindsey Tramuta
